Music download chart to ignore non-subsribtion services

The Official UK Charts Company is planning a download top 40 chart that will receive its data from subscription services such as Pressplay and MusicNow. “Illegal” file-sharing networks such as FastTrack (KaZaA), Gnutella and WinMX will be ignored.

Most charts are based on sales data and have been scorned recently because they “do not reflect consumer choice”, according to critics.

“The way people buy their music is changing with new technology,” a spokesman for the Official UK Charts Company told Reuters on Wednesday. “We need to show that our charts are reflecting that.”

“Ultimately our long term goal is to see them incorporated with the singles charts.”
